Job Details

A fantastic opportunity has arisen for an Assistant Veterinary Surgeon to join our team based between our two small animal practices in Cowbridge and Llantwit Major.

This role works to a 4-day week (09:00-19:00) with 1:4 half weekends. 

We offer a competitive salary of up to £40,000 per annum, depending on experience which includes £4200 housing allowance, vehicle or £2500 allowance.

A generous CPD allowance of £1500 with 3-days CPD leave. RCVS, VDS and BVA membership fees. 5 weeks annual leave plus bank holidays. 

Additional benefits include: Paid sabbatical after every five years’ service, Company discounts and reward scheme, Access to Employee Assistance Programme, 100% attendance scheme and ‘Peternity’ leave. 

Skills and experience:

The successful candidate will have at least six months’ UK small animal practice (or UK equivalent) experience.

You must have a client-oriented approach and excellent communication skills, work to a very high standard both medically and surgically and have the drive and ambition to help develop these branches further.

The ideal candidate will be an enthusiastic team player and have a passion for delivering outstanding care to your patients, as well as a first-class service to your clients. Some sole charge (consulting only) will be required at our Llantwit Major clinic.

Branch:

Cowbridge is an affluent market town with a traditional high street full of independent shops and has once been voted the best place to live in Wales by the Sunday Times.

Llantwit Major is a pretty seaside town 5 minutes’ drive away from the beach and both practices are only a short drive away from Cardiff and its Airport.

Our small animal practices have a supportive team of two experienced and knowledgeable Vets one of whom does Orthopaedics, a friendly nursing team of four and a receptionist - both the practices have well-equipped facilities and see a varied caseload.
